The great Aglianico del Vulture festival in the heart of Venosa
The Aglianica Wine Festival is the most important event dedicated to Aglianico del Vulture, the great Lucanian red that is born on the volcanic soils of Monte Vulture. Organized by the association Liberovino, the festival takes place in the historic center of Venosa, the birthplace of the poet Horace, with the evocative Pirro del Balzo Castle as its backdrop.
The heart of the event is the "Mondo Aglianico" tasting counter, which showcases the grape variety in its various territorial expressions โ from Vulture to the Campanian Taurasi and Taburno โ alongside the other DOCs of Basilicata. The tastings are accompanied by guided seminars by major national associations such as AIS and Go Wine, dedicated to Aglianico and native grape varieties.
Alongside the wine, the "Officine del Gusto" (Taste Workshops) offer tastings of typical products โ cheeses, cured meats, honey, oil, grappas, and craft beers โ while show cooking by chefs takes place in the former church of San Domenico. The festival comes alive with street artists, the barrel race, the historical re-enactment "La storia bandita" (The Banished History), and live music, in an intertwining of food and wine, culture, and fun that makes Venosa, for a weekend, the Lucanian capital of wine.
Included among the Most Beautiful Villages in Italy, Venosa offers visitors to the festival an extraordinary heritage: the Abbey of the Most Holy Trinity, the Archaeological Park, and the Aragonese Castle. Aglianica thus becomes an opportunity to combine the discovery of great Lucanian wine with that of a territory rich in history.
The XVI edition of the Aglianica Wine Festival is scheduled from October 3 to 5, 2026, in the historic center of Venosa, at the foot of the Pirro del Balzo Castle. Three days dedicated to Aglianico del Vulture and the great wines of the South, with tastings, seminars, gastronomy, and entertainment.

Approximate hours: Friday and Saturday 5:00 PM-12:00 AM, Sunday 11:00 AM-12:00 AM. The detailed program will be announced in the weeks preceding the event.
Venosa can be reached from the A16 highway (Candela exit) or the SS 658 Potenza-Melfi. The festival takes place in the historic center, around the Pirro del Balzo Castle.
Free admission on Friday; on other days, a tasting voucher (glass and tastings) is required. Shows and entertainment are free; some seminars require booking.
Venosa and the villages of the Vulture region offer numerous accommodation facilities, farm stays, and wineries with hospitality services.
